  2. Lincoln is a city in Benton County, Missouri, United States. The population was 1,144 at the 2020 census. [4] History. A post office called Lincoln was established in 1866. [5] . The city was named for Abraham Lincoln, sixteenth President of the United States. [6] Geography. Lincoln is located at 38°23′32″N 93°19′58″W (38.392258, -93.332766). [7]

  3. Lincoln County is located in the eastern part of the U.S. state of Missouri. As of the 2020 census, the population was 59,574. [1] Its county seat is Troy. [2] The county was founded December 14, 1818, and named for Major General Benjamin Lincoln of the American Revolutionary War. [3]

  5. Lincoln lies in Benton County, situated in the west-central region of the United States in the state of Missouri. Located south of the Osage River, it is northeast of Warsaw and northwest of Lake of the Ozarks. The city is approximately halfway between Kansas City and St. Louis.
